The 1972 Championship: A Defining Moment

The 1972 Stanley Cup marked a pivotal moment for the Bruins. Led by legendary players like Bobby Orr and Phil Esposito, the team overcame the New York Rangers in a thrilling six-game series. This victory ended a 29-year championship drought for the franchise and captivated a generation of hockey fans. It remains a cornerstone of the Bruins’ legacy.

Bobby Orr’s iconic game-winning goal in Game 4 is consistently ranked among the most memorable moments in Stanley Cup Finals history. The image of Orr airborne, stick raised in celebration, became instantly iconic, symbolizing triumph and athletic prowess. The 1972 team’s success wasn’t just about individual stars, but a cohesive unit playing with unmatched determination.

The 2011 Championship: A new Generation of Champions

Nearly four decades later, the Bruins once again ascended to the pinnacle of professional hockey, claiming the Stanley Cup in 2011. Facing the Vancouver Canucks, the Bruins battled through a hard-fought seven-game series, culminating in a decisive 4-0 victory on Canadian ice. this championship signaled the arrival of a new generation of Bruins stars, including Tim Thomas, Patrice Bergeron, and Zdeno Chara.

Tim Thomas’s stellar goaltending performance throughout the 2011 playoffs earned him the conn Smythe Trophy as the most valuable player. His extraordinary saves and unwavering commitment were instrumental in securing the championship for Boston.The 2011 victory demonstrated the Bruins’ resilience and ability to perform under immense pressure.

Comparing the Championship Teams

While separated by almost 40 years, both the 1972 and 2011 Bruins teams shared a common thread: an unwavering commitment to teamwork and a refusal to yield. However, key differences also characterized each era.

Feature 1972 Bruins 2011 Bruins
Key Players Bobby Orr, Phil Esposito, Ken Hodge Tim Thomas, Patrice Bergeron, Zdeno Chara
Style of Play Offensive firepower Defensive Solidity & Goaltending
Opponent in Finals New York Rangers Vancouver Canucks
Series Result 4-2 4-3

The 1972 team was renowned for its explosive offensive capabilities, while the 2011 squad built its success on a suffocating defensive system and exceptional goaltending. Both approaches proved remarkably effective,illustrating the adaptability of the franchise across different eras of the NHL.

Frequently Asked Questions about the Boston Bruins’ Stanley cup Championships

  • What years did the Boston Bruins win the Stanley Cup? The Bruins have won the Stanley Cup in 1929, 1939, 1941, 1970, 1972 and 2011.
  • Who was the coach of the 1972 Boston Bruins? Tom Johnson was the head coach of the 1972 Boston Bruins championship team.
  • Who won the Conn Smythe Trophy in 2011? Tim Thomas, the Bruins’ goaltender, won the Conn Smythe Trophy in 2011.
  • What made the 2011 Bruins team so triumphant? A combination of strong goaltending, a suffocating defense, and timely scoring propelled the 2011 Bruins to victory.
